@Override protected void setUp() throws Exception { super.setUp(); handler = new TestLogHandler(); // You could also apply it higher up the Logger hierarchy than this ExampleClassUnderTest.logger.addHandler(handler); ExampleClassUnderTest.logger.setUseParentHandlers(false); // optional stack.addTearDown( new TearDown() { @Override public void tearDown() throws Exception { ExampleClassUnderTest.logger.setUseParentHandlers(true); ExampleClassUnderTest.logger.removeHandler(handler); } }); }

public void testEnqueueAndDispatch_withLabeledExceptions() { Object listener = new MyListener(); ListenerCallQueue<Object> queue = new ListenerCallQueue<>(); queue.addListener(listener, directExecutor()); queue.enqueue(THROWING_EVENT, "custom-label"); Logger logger = Logger.getLogger(ListenerCallQueue.class.getName()); logger.setLevel(Level.SEVERE); TestLogHandler logHandler = new TestLogHandler(); logger.addHandler(logHandler); try { queue.dispatch(); } finally { logger.removeHandler(logHandler); } assertEquals(1, logHandler.getStoredLogRecords().size()); assertEquals( "Exception while executing callback: MyListener custom-label", logHandler.getStoredLogRecords().get(0).getMessage()); }
/** * Catches a bug where when constructing a service manager failed, later interactions with the * service could cause IllegalStateExceptions inside the partially constructed ServiceManager. * This ISE wouldn't actually bubble up but would get logged by ExecutionQueue. This obfuscated * the original error (which was not constructing ServiceManager correctly). */ public void testPartiallyConstructedManager() { Logger logger = Logger.getLogger("global"); logger.setLevel(Level.FINEST); TestLogHandler logHandler = new TestLogHandler(); logger.addHandler(logHandler); NoOpService service = new NoOpService(); service.startAsync(); try { new ServiceManager(Arrays.asList(service)); fail(); } catch (IllegalArgumentException expected) { } service.stopAsync(); // Nothing was logged! assertEquals(0, logHandler.getStoredLogRecords().size()); }
public static void testLoggingSuppressor() throws IOException { TestLogHandler logHandler = new TestLogHandler(); Closeables.logger.addHandler(logHandler); try { Closer closer = new Closer(new Closer.LoggingSuppressor()); TestCloseable c1 = closer.register(TestCloseable.throwsOnClose(new IOException())); TestCloseable c2 = closer.register(TestCloseable.throwsOnClose(new RuntimeException())); try { throw closer.rethrow(new IOException("thrown"), IOException.class); } catch (IOException expected) { } assertTrue(logHandler.getStoredLogRecords().isEmpty()); closer.close(); assertEquals(2, logHandler.getStoredLogRecords().size()); LogRecord record = logHandler.getStoredLogRecords().get(0); assertEquals("Suppressing exception thrown when closing " + c2, record.getMessage()); record = logHandler.getStoredLogRecords().get(1); assertEquals("Suppressing exception thrown when closing " + c1, record.getMessage()); } finally { Closeables.logger.removeHandler(logHandler); } }
